The Properties of Steel and Fire Resistance
Steel is a well - known material for its strength and durability. When it comes to fire resistance, steel has some inherent characteristics that set it apart from other pallet materials like wood or plastic.
One of the key features of steel is its high melting point. Most steels have a melting point in the range of 1370 - 1510 degrees Celsius (2500 - 2750 degrees Fahrenheit). This means that in normal fire situations, where the temperature rarely reaches such extreme levels, steel pallets will not melt immediately. For example, in a typical warehouse fire, the temperature may reach around 600 - 800 degrees Celsius (1100 - 1470 degrees Fahrenheit). At these temperatures, steel retains its structural integrity for a certain period, providing valuable time for fire - fighting efforts and evacuation.
Another advantage of steel is its non - combustible nature. Unlike wood pallets, which can catch fire easily and fuel the spread of flames, steel does not burn. It does not contribute to the growth of a fire by releasing flammable gases or providing additional fuel. This is a significant benefit in fire safety, as it helps to contain the fire and prevent it from spreading rapidly through a storage area.
However, it's important to note that while steel is non - combustible, it can lose its strength when exposed to high temperatures for an extended period. As the temperature rises, the steel begins to expand, and its yield strength decreases. This can lead to structural deformation, which may cause the pallets to collapse under the weight of the stored goods.
Factors Affecting the Fire Resistance of Steel Pallets
Several factors can influence the fire resistance of steel pallets.
1. Thickness of the Steel
The thickness of the steel used in the pallet construction plays a vital role. Thicker steel sections have a greater heat - absorbing capacity and can withstand higher temperatures for longer. For instance, a pallet made from 3 - millimeter thick steel will generally have better fire resistance than one made from 1 - millimeter thick steel. The thicker steel takes longer to heat up and lose its strength, providing more time for the fire to be controlled.
2. Coating and Treatment
Some steel pallets are coated or treated to enhance their fire resistance. Fire - retardant coatings can be applied to the surface of the steel. These coatings work by forming a protective layer that slows down the transfer of heat to the steel. They may also release non - flammable gases when heated, which can help to smother the fire. Additionally, galvanized steel pallets, which have a zinc coating, offer some protection against corrosion and can also have a minor impact on fire resistance, as the zinc layer can act as a barrier to heat transfer.
3. Design and Construction
The design of the steel pallet can also affect its fire resistance. Pallets with a more open design allow for better ventilation, which can help to reduce the build - up of heat and prevent the formation of hotspots. On the other hand, pallets with a closed or solid structure may trap heat, leading to a faster increase in temperature and a greater risk of structural failure.


Practical Applications in Fire - Prone Environments
Steel pallets are widely used in industries where fire safety is a concern.
1. Chemical Storage
In chemical warehouses, where there is a high risk of fire due to the presence of flammable chemicals, steel pallets are an ideal choice. Their non - combustible nature ensures that they do not contribute to the spread of fire. Moreover, their high strength allows them to safely store heavy chemical containers. For example, large drums of solvents or corrosive chemicals can be stored on steel pallets without the worry of the pallets catching fire or collapsing under the weight.
2. Food Processing
Food processing facilities also require strict fire safety measures. Steel pallets are hygienic and non - combustible, making them suitable for storing food products. In case of a fire, the steel pallets will not release harmful chemicals or contaminants into the food, ensuring the safety of the products. They can also withstand the high - pressure cleaning and sanitization processes commonly used in food processing plants.
3. Warehouses with Flammable Goods
Warehouses that store flammable goods such as paper, textiles, or plastics can benefit from using steel pallets. The fire - resistant properties of steel pallets help to contain the fire and prevent it from spreading to other areas of the warehouse. This can significantly reduce the damage caused by a fire and minimize the risk to employees and the surrounding environment.
